Bahai HQ in Israel a UNESCO World Heritage Site

So few people have visited Israel and as such they are not aware that the Bahai have their international headquarters in Israel. Some may know of the persecution of the Bahai's by Iran. However, let us show you some of the beauty that sits upon Mount Carmel, Haifa, Israel. It is now a UNESCO World Heritage site. Israel is the home of at least 15 different religions and Israelis defend this land of the prophets.



Mount Carmel holds so much history.

King David did some of his courting on Mount Carmel.

Elijah's Cave is there, in fact there are at least three different places
considered sacred places of Elijah on Mount Carmel.

Some Israelis say there was an Essene school there in ancient days.

The largest Arab Druze village is also on Mt Carmel.

Mount Carmel was definitely popular with the prophets in ancient times
